Radio evangelist Curtis Howe Springer squatted on this federal soda-springs parcel from 1944 to 1974, running the sham Zzyzx Mineral Springs health resort until the BLM evicted him. The palm-lined compound on Soda Dry Lake is now the CSU Desert Studies Center inside Mojave National Preserve, its vintage buildings maintained for researchers. The 4.5-mile Zzyzx Road off I-15 is open to the public, who can legally stroll Lake Tuendae and the grounds; keep clear of occupied research buildings and carry water — it is still the Mojave.
